Taxonomic Classification

Rank Bali Shortcake Pleurisy Root
Kingdom Animalia (Animals) Plantae (Plants)
Phylum Cnidaria (Cnidarians)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ants)
Class Anthozoa Magnoliopsida (Dicots)
Order Scleractinia (Scleractinia) Gentianales (Gentianales)
Family Acroporidae Apocynaceae
Genus Acropora Asclepias
Species Acropora latistella Asclepias incarnata

Bali Shortcake

The Bali Shortcake (Acropora latistella) is a species in the genus Acropora. It is currently classified as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List. Native to Asia, inhabiting ecosystems characteristic of the region.
